backend knocking
Alright, I got a little puzzler that's not motor related. I've taken my car to several mechanics on this, and they can't seem to figure out what the problem is without wanting to take apart all of my rear suspension. I get a wierd knocking/clicking sound coming distinctly from the rear right wheel well(say that 4 times fast!!) when I make 90 degree right hand turns. It only happens on right turns, noise is strictly limited to right rear wheel well, and varies in intensity/frequency depending on how long the car has been on(longer it's been driven, less noise it makes). Yeah, I know, sounds like might be a CV joint, but then...........a little while back, I blew my rear right tire, and had to put a loaner on for 2 days that had a much lower speed rating/less grip. This caused the clicking/knocking noise to completely disappear. Once I replaced the loaner w/better tire, noise came back in full force. Anyone got any ideas???
